How much do commissary associ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for commissary associate in the United States is $19.87,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.90 and $20.67 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Commissary Associates?

Commissary Associates are employees who work in commissaries, which are grocery stores typically located on military bases. Their duties can include stocking shelves, assisting customers, operating cash registers, and maintaining store cleanliness. They play a key role in ensuring that military personnel and their families have access to groceries and household items at discounted prices. Commissary Associates may also help with inventory control and unloading deliveries. The position often requires good customer service skills and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

Troubadour Golf & Field Club is seeking a Commissary Associate to join the Commissary Team
***Full-Time hourly position. Starting pay $18-$20 per hour.***

Key Responsibilities

  • Participate in daily morning meeting with Commissary staff
  • Receive POs from Commissary supervisor and collect product as assigned
  • Understand basic product ID and quality of ingredients to fulfill orders properly
  • Check out final PO orders with the Supervisor before sending them to each department
  • Deliver product to appropriate outlet, stage in assigned area, get signed copy by outlet manager
  • Organize assigned area in commissary and daily maintenance
  • Participate in the assigned daily, weekly, and special projects cleaning lists
  • Unload and distribute large deliveries to assigned areas
  • Carry out any other and all tasks as assigned by the commissary supervisor / manager.
  • Identify damage, loss, or surplus of gods and materials stored in the commissary.
  • To ensure that all equipment is properly functioning and utilized within the department.
  • Ensures that all malfunctions are reported to the Manager/Supervisor on duty immediately
  • Close commissary using the provided closing checklist

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ma
  • A minimum of one year of experience in Warehousing or Hotel environment, Distribution, Receiving and Warehouse Transportation functions.
  • Basic knowledge of product ID and food safety
  • Must be a motivated self-starter who displays initiative and possesses the ability to troubleshoot.
  • Ability to deal with a wide range of employees including upper management with regards to the day-to-day operation of the Commissary and special projects within the Purchasing & Logistics Department.
  • Telehandler and forklift operations a plus
  • Valid Health Certificate

Additional Requirements

Positive attitude, professional demeanor, and exceptional communication and interpersonal skills to deliver service to members, guests, and team members.

Must be able to work flexible work hours/schedule including evenings, weekends, and holidays. Long hours may be required due to business demands.

Ability to work in a team environment.

Ability to stay calm and focused during the busiest of times.

Ability to read, write, speak, and understand English; additional languages preferred.

Ability to meet the physical demands of the position including, but not limited to, working indoors and outdoors in all weather conditions, standing, walking, and moving for periods of greater than eight (8) hours, and lifting and carrying items sometimes greater than fifty (50) pounds.

About Us

Troubadour Golf & Field Club is a private community, conveniently located just 30 miles south of downtown Nashville. Set on 980 acres, Troubadour features 375 residences; an 18-hole Tom Fazio-designed championship golf course; a multi-sport complex; an organic farm and world-class restaurants; private recording studios; music venues; and wellness facilities.
